因为我有多个DBNumberEditEh1.Value这样类似的值..比如
DBNumberEditEh2.Value
DBNumberEditEh3.Value
DBNumberEditEh4.Value如何实现
DBNumberEditEh4.Value的值为
DBNumberEditEh1.Value + DBNumberEditEh2.Value + DBNumberEditEh3.Value当DBNumberEditEh1.Value 或 DBNumberEditEh2.Value 或 DBNumberEditEh3.Value 的值发生改变时,
DBNumberEditEh4.Value的值也随即更新.
谢谢!

解决方案 »

  1.   

    双击DBNumberEditEh1的OnChenge属性,在随后的代码中填写如下内容:DBNumberEditEh4.Value:= DBNumberEditEh1.Value + DBNumberEditEh2.Value + DBNumberEditEh3.Value 再将DBNumberEditEh2.Value、DBNumberEditEh3.Value的相应属性值都选择DBNumberEditEh1.Value的OnChenge属性值。
      

  2.   

    双击DBNumberEditEh1的OnChenge属性,在随后的代码中填写如下内容:
    DBNumberEditEh4.Value:= DBNumberEditEh1.Value + DBNumberEditEh2.Value + DBNumberEditEh3.Value
    再将DBNumberEditEh2、DBNumberEditEh3的相应属性值都选择DBNumberEditEh1的OnChenge属性值。
      

  3.   

    我这么做了..DBNumberEditEh4.Value的值不发生任何改变,还是空的..这是为什么??
      

  4.   

    噢...我刚刚再做了一个测试..是能生成结果..但是为什么我只输DBNumberEditEh1.Value的值...而后面的不输,而为什么DBNumberEditEh4.Value的值没有呢...要输了后面的这个值才会变???
    万分感谢
      

  5.   

    焦点离开时,Delphi才会触发OnChange事件,所以...
      

  6.   

    还想请问下:
    我在程序中加了一个ADOTable1...连结了aa表
    aa表中有je1字段.我怎么样把DBNumberEditEh1.Value的值写入aa表的je1数据列中.
    万分感谢
      

  7.   

    可视控件与数据表的链接需要DataSource控件,而该控件有个onUpdate属性,可以实现你要的结果